Common Garage Door Repair Scams in Cherokee Village
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ators
Upfront Payment Demand
Scammer shows up, 'diagnoses' a major issue, demands hundreds in cash upfront, then vanishes without returning.
Unnecessary Replacement
Claims springs, opener, or entire door must be replaced now (often not true), quotes sky-high after low phone estimate.
Bait-and-Switch Pricing
Quotes cheap over phone for 'quick fix,' arrives and says it's much worse, charges triple without approval.
Phantom Emergency Service
Calls or shows up uninvited claiming 'neighborhood alert' for door recalls or hazards, pushes unnecessary service.
How to Verify a Professional
Insurance
Ask for a Certificate of Insurance (COI) listing general liability (at least $1M) and workers' comp. Call the insurer to confirm it's current and valid.
Licensing
Check the Arkansas Contractors Licensing Board (ACLB) website at aclb.arkansas.gov or call (501) 372-4661. Search by business name or license number. Many garage door pros hold residential contractor licenses.
References
Request 3 recent references from Sharp County or nearby. Call them yourself to ask about work quality, timeliness, and if they'd hire again.
